Transaction

95bbf8de2eec785ee4c0ab30d7a7892e15ba1a164472c2f51d00163eea826d11

Summary

In Block712034
TimeSat, 25 May 2024 04:48:15 UTC
Total Input840.499981 Nebula
Total Output874.499981 Nebula
Fees0 Nebula

Details

Raw Transaction